Anonyme Dateifreigabe ohne Anmeldefenster vom Windows 7-Server bis zu XP-Clients

11

Ich versuche, Computern in einem kleinen LAN schreibgeschützten, anonymen Zugriff auf Dateien zu gewähren, die von einer Windows 7-Workstation freigegeben wurden (nennen wir es WIN7SVR). Insbesondere möchte ich nicht, dass Clients sich mit einem Anmeldefenster befassen müssen, wenn sie zu z. B. \\WIN7SVRim Windows Explorer navigieren , aber wir haben keine Domäne, und die Synchronisierung von Konten zwischen Server und Clients wäre nicht möglich. Es gibt sowohl Windows 7- als auch Windows XP-Clients, die Zugriff auf diese Freigaben benötigen.

Ich habe dies für Windows 7-Clients zum Laufen gebracht, indem ich nur das Gastkonto in WIN7SVR aktiviert und die entsprechenden Freigabeberechtigungen festgelegt habe. Andere Windows 7-Computer versuchen anscheinend automatisch, sich als Gast anzumelden, sodass sich ihre Benutzer nicht mit dem Anmeldefenster befassen müssen. Das Problem liegt bei den XP-Clients - sie können auf den Server zugreifen, wenn der Benutzer im Anmeldefenster "Gast" eingibt, aber ich möchte nicht, dass Benutzer dies tun müssen. Soweit ich weiß, läuft dies nach meinem begrenzten Verständnis der Windows-Dateifreigabe darauf hinaus, Nullsitzungen Zugriff auf Dateifreigaben auf WIN7SVR zu gewähren.

Aber ich habe bisher keinen Erfolg in dieser Hinsicht gehabt. Ich habe im lokalen Gruppenrichtlinien-Editor auf dem Windows 7-Server Folgendes versucht:

  • Set Netzwerkzugriff: Let Everyone Berechtigungen gelten Benutzer anonym auf Aktiviert
  • Set Netzwerkzugriff: Anonymen Zugriff auf Named Pipes und Freigaben für Behinderte
  • Die Namen der entsprechenden Freigaben wurden zum Netzwerkzugriff hinzugefügt : Freigaben, auf die anonym zugegriffen werden kann
  • "ANONYMOUS LOGON" hinzugefügt, um über das Netzwerk unter Zuweisung von Benutzerrechten über das Netzwerk auf diesen Computer zuzugreifen

Jeder Rat wäre sehr dankbar ... Ich bin größtenteils ein Unix-Typ, daher fühle ich mich mit Windows-Dateifreigabe etwas außerhalb meiner Liga. Ich verstehe, dass jede Art von anonymem Zugriff auf Dateifreigaben unter Sicherheitsgesichtspunkten im Allgemeinen nicht ideal ist, aber in diesem Fall die praktischste Lösung für uns ist und der Zugriff auf unser Netzwerk so gut kontrolliert wird, dass die Sicherheit auf Freigabeebene nicht gewährleistet ist. kein Problem.

mshroyer
quelle

Antworten:

0

Dies ist möglicherweise vollständig deaktiviert, aber ist für die XP-Clients die einfache Dateifreigabe aktiviert? Und sind sie XP Pro oder zu Hause?

So überprüfen Sie die einfache Dateifreigabe:

  1. Öffnen Sie ein Explorer-Fenster
  2. Klicken Sie auf Extras, Ordneroptionen
  3. Am Ende der Liste befindet sich das Kontrollkästchen für einfaches Filesharing.
Tim Coker
quelle
Die XP-Clients sind XP Pro und die einfache Dateifreigabe ist deaktiviert. Vielen Dank für den Vorschlag, aber ich habe versucht, die einfache Freigabe auf einem der XP-Computer zu aktivieren, aber es hat keinen Unterschied gemacht.
mshroyer
Leider bin ich dem nie auf den Grund gegangen, aber wir haben schließlich eine Neuinstallation auf den XP Pro-Computern durchgeführt, und jetzt funktioniert Ihre Lösung wie erwartet.
mshroyer
3

Versuchen Sie, das Gastkonto zu aktivieren:

  • Systemsteuerung -> Verwaltung -> Computerverwaltung> Lokale Benutzer und Gruppen> Benutzer
  • Klicken Sie mit der rechten Maustaste auf Gast> Eigenschaften
  • Deaktivieren Sie "Konto ist deaktiviert"

Durch Aktivieren dieses Kontos wurde dieses Problem unter Windows Server 2008 R2 behoben.

Matthew Lock
quelle
1

Konnte dies auch für eine Weile nicht zum Laufen bringen. Das Problem tritt nur bei einigen XP-Installationen auf, jedoch nie bei sieben.

Dies hat das Problem für mich gelöst, hoffe es wird einigen Leuten helfen!

Netzwerkfreigabe auf Server 2008 mit Anmeldung

DODMax
quelle
1

Ich hatte das gleiche Problem in die entgegengesetzte Richtung. Ich habe versucht, einen an einen Windows XP-Computer angeschlossenen Drucker freizugeben, während alle meine Clients Windows 7 verwendeten. Ich habe viele Dinge ausprobiert. Am Ende habe ich das Problem folgendermaßen gelöst:

  1. Einfache Freigabe auf dem Windows XP-Computer aktiviert.
  2. Führen Sie den Netzwerk-Setup-Assistenten aus (auf dem Windows XP-Computer).
  3. Windows XP neu gestartet.

Jetzt kann ich den Windows XP-Drucker freigeben und unter Windows 7 verwenden, ohne ein Anmeldefenster zu erhalten.

Cesar Daniel
quelle